Flutter写Android页面
Flutter是一种跨平台移动应用开发框架,它可以让开发者使用一套代码同时构建iOS和Android应用。在Flutter中,我们可以使用Dart语言来编写页面,并使用丰富的UI库来构建界面。本文将介绍如何使用Flutter来编写Android页面,并提供一些代码示例来帮助你入门。
准备工作
在开始之前,我们需要确保已经安装了Flutter开发环境。你可以根据官方文档来安装和配置Flutter。一旦环境搭建完成,我们就可以开始编写我们的第一个Android页面了。
创建一个Flutter项目
首先,打开终端或命令行工具,使用以下命令来创建一个新的Flutter项目:
flutter create my_app
cd my_app
这将创建一个名为my_app
的文件夹,并将你的终端工作目录切换到该文件夹中。
编写页面代码
接下来,打开你喜欢的代码编辑器,并在lib/main.dart
文件中编写页面代码。以下是一个简单的页面示例:
import 'package:flutter/material.dart';
void main() {
runApp(MyApp());
}
class MyApp extends StatelessWidget {
@override
Widget build(BuildContext context) {
return MaterialApp(
title: 'Flutter Demo',
theme: ThemeData(
primarySwatch: Colors.blue,
),
home: MyHomePage(),
);
}
}
class MyHomePage extends StatelessWidget {
@override
Widget build(BuildContext context) {
return Scaffold(
appBar: AppBar(
title: Text('Flutter Demo Home Page'),
),
body: Center(
child: Text(
'Hello, Flutter!',
style: TextStyle(fontSize: 24),
),
),
);
}
}
在这个示例中,我们创建了一个名为MyApp
的主应用程序类,并在build
方法中返回了一个MaterialApp
,它是Flutter中的主要应用程序容器。我们还创建了一个名为MyHomePage
的页面类,并在build
方法中返回一个包含标题栏和正文的Scaffold
小部件。
运行应用程序
一旦你完成了页面的编写,你可以使用以下命令来运行你的应用程序:
flutter run
这将编译并安装你的应用程序,并在连接的Android设备或模拟器上运行。
结论
在本文中,我们简要介绍了如何使用Flutter来编写Android页面。我们创建了一个简单的页面,并提供了一些代码示例来帮助你入门。希望这篇文章对你有所帮助,祝你在Flutter开发中取得成功!
甘特图
下面是一个使用Mermaid语法绘制的甘特图,显示了在编写Android页面的过程中的各个步骤和时间线。
gantt
title 编写Android页面
dateFormat YYYY-MM-DD
section 准备工作
安装Flutter环境 :done, 2022-01-01, 1d
创建Flutter项目 :done, 2022-01-02, 1d
section 编写页面代码
编写主应用程序类 :done, 2022-01-03, 2d
编写页面类 :done, 2022-01-05, 2d
section 运行应用程序
编译和安装应用程序 :done, 2022-01-07, 1d
运行应用程序 :done, 2022-01-08, 1d
以上是关于如何使用Flutter编写Android页面的科普文章。希望这篇文章对正在学习Flutter的开发者们有所帮助。如果有任何问题或疑问,请随时留言。感谢阅读!